| import java.io.ByteArrayInputStream; |
| import java.io.InputStream; |
| |
| import javax.sound.sampled.AudioFormat; |
| import javax.sound.sampled.AudioInputStream; |
| import javax.sound.sampled.AudioSystem; |
| import javax.sound.sampled.spi.FormatConversionProvider; |
| |
| import static java.util.ServiceLoader.load; |
| |
| /** |
| * @test |
| * @bug 8146144 |
| */ |
| public final class GetAudioStreamConversionSupported { |
| |
| static final AudioFormat.Encoding[] encodings = { |
| AudioFormat.Encoding.ALAW, AudioFormat.Encoding.ULAW, |
| AudioFormat.Encoding.PCM_SIGNED, AudioFormat.Encoding.PCM_UNSIGNED, |
| AudioFormat.Encoding.PCM_FLOAT, new AudioFormat.Encoding("Test") |
| }; |
| |
| public static void main(final String[] args) { |
| for (final int sampleSize : new int[]{4, 8, 16, 24, 32}) { |
| for (final AudioFormat.Encoding enc : encodings) { |
| for (final Boolean endian : new boolean[]{false, true}) { |
| testAS(enc, endian, sampleSize); |
| for (final FormatConversionProvider fcp : load |
| (FormatConversionProvider.class)) { |
| testFCP(fcp, enc, endian, sampleSize); |
| } |
| } |
| } |
| } |
| } |
| |
| /** |
| * Tests the part of AudioSystem API, which implemented via |
| * FormatConversionProvider. |
| * <p> |
| * AudioSystem always support conversion to the same encoding/format. |
| */ |
| private static void testAS(final AudioFormat.Encoding enc, |
| final Boolean endian, final int sampleSize) { |
| final AudioInputStream ais = getStream(enc, endian, sampleSize); |
| final AudioFormat format = ais.getFormat(); |
| if (!AudioSystem.isConversionSupported(enc, format)) { |
| throw new RuntimeException("Format: " + format); |
| } |
| if (!AudioSystem.isConversionSupported(format, format)) { |
| throw new RuntimeException("Format: " + format); |
| } |
| AudioSystem.getAudioInputStream(enc, ais); |
| AudioSystem.getAudioInputStream(format, ais); |
| } |
| |
| /** |
| * Tests the FormatConversionProvider API directly. |
| */ |
| private static void testFCP(final FormatConversionProvider fcp, |
| final AudioFormat.Encoding enc, |
| final Boolean endian, final int sampleSize) { |
| System.out.println("fcp = " + fcp); |
| final AudioInputStream ais = getStream(enc, endian, sampleSize); |
| final AudioFormat frmt = ais.getFormat(); |
| if (fcp.isConversionSupported(enc, frmt)) { |
| try { |
| fcp.getAudioInputStream(enc, ais); |
| } catch (final IllegalArgumentException ex) { |
| throw new RuntimeException("Format: " + frmt, ex); |
| } |
| } else { |
| try { |
| fcp.getAudioInputStream(enc, ais); |
| throw new RuntimeException("Format: " + frmt); |
| } catch (final IllegalArgumentException ignored) { |
| } |
| try { |
| fcp.getAudioInputStream(frmt, ais); |
| throw new RuntimeException("Format: " + frmt); |
| } catch (final IllegalArgumentException ignored) { |
| } |
| } |
| if (fcp.isConversionSupported(frmt, frmt)) { |
| try { |
| fcp.getAudioInputStream(enc, ais); |
| fcp.getAudioInputStream(frmt, ais); |
| } catch (final IllegalArgumentException ex) { |
| throw new RuntimeException("Format: " + frmt, ex); |
| } |
| } else { |
| try { |
| fcp.getAudioInputStream(frmt, ais); |
| throw new RuntimeException("Format: " + frmt); |
| } catch (final IllegalArgumentException ignored) { |
| } |
| } |
| } |
| |
| private static AudioInputStream getStream(final AudioFormat.Encoding enc, |
| final Boolean end, |
| final int sampleSize) { |
| final AudioFormat ftmt |
| = new AudioFormat(enc, 8000, sampleSize, 1, 1, 8000, end); |
| final byte[] fakedata = new byte[100]; |
| final InputStream in = new ByteArrayInputStream(fakedata); |
| return new AudioInputStream(in, ftmt, fakedata.length); |
| } |
| } |
